### **Navigating the Road**

The Road to Hana stretches for approximately 64 miles along Maui's rugged coastline, with over 600 hairpin turns and dozens of narrow bridges. While the journey can be challenging, it's well worth the effort for the stunning views and natural beauty you'll encounter along the way. Take your time, drive cautiously, and be prepared for narrow roads and steep cliffsides.

### **Must-See Stops Along the Way**

There are countless stops and attractions to explore along the Road to Hana, but some highlights not to be missed include:

- **Twin Falls* Begin your journey with a refreshing swim at Twin Falls, one of the first waterfalls you'll encounter along the road.
- **Wai'anapanapa State Park* Explore the rugged coastline, black sand beaches, and lava caves of this stunning state park.
- **Hana Town* Discover the charming town of Hana, where you can visit the Hana Cultural Center, sample local cuisine, and relax on the beach.
- **Seven Sacred Pools* Take a dip in the pristine waters of the Seven Sacred Pools at Ohe'o Gulch, located in the Haleakalā National Park.
- **Pipiwai Trail* Embark on a scenic hike through bamboo forests and past towering waterfalls on this popular trail in Haleakalā National Park.

### **Safety Tips**

While the Road to Hana is undoubtedly beautiful, it can also be treacherous, especially for inexperienced drivers. Here are a few safety tips to keep in mind:

- **Drive with caution* Take your time and drive slowly, especially around curves and narrow bridges.
- **Stay hydrated* Be sure to drink plenty of water, especially if you plan on hiking or swimming.
- **Watch for flash floods* Be mindful of weather conditions and be prepared for sudden rain showers, which can lead to flash floods in some areas.
- **Respect the environment* Leave no trace and respect the natural beauty of Maui by staying on designated trails and disposing of waste properly.
